Transaction 531ecd08d8c8db81134848ed6a670c3f0d20dd5578acff8cfdcf1a0b98083679
1 Input
2 Outputs
- 531ecd08d8c8db81134848ed6a670c3f0d20dd5578acff8cfdcf1a0b98083679:0
- 531ecd08d8c8db81134848ed6a670c3f0d20dd5578acff8cfdcf1a0b98083679:1
value 249987295
address 16u2EZEsSig949tXXCS4U8HdPaHfLpZhsQ
value 250000000
address 1GYLXyrVshRRyjnUsAooGii8w1TnbtmqGJ